    I would ask to hang flyers at local businesses, and be in touch with the local Animal organizations – like Kitty Harbor, and the FAF group that operates out of Next to Nature in the junction.

    And what about Vet Clinics? I would let Diesel’s Vet know for sure that he is missing – and give them a flyer.
    Cats can travel, and Diesel may have ventured too far, and cannot find his way back.
    He is microchipped, so that is definitely your best bet on getting him back if he was found by another.
